Materials Needed
- Yarn: Lightweight, soft acrylic or cotton yarn
- Hook: Size H/8 (5.0 mm) crochet hook
- Gauge: 4 inches = 12 double crochet (dc) and 6 rows
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Start with a Magic Ring
Begin by creating a magic ring. This technique allows you to start your shawl without a gap in the center. To do this, wrap the yarn around your fingers to form a loop, then pull the working yarn through the loop to create the ring.
Step 2: Row 1
- Chain 4 (this counts as your first double crochet and a chain 1).
- In the magic ring, work 2 double crochets (dc).
- Chain 1.
- Work 1 more double crochet in the magic ring.
- Turn your work.
Step 3: Row 2
- Chain 4 (counts as your first dc).
- In the first chain-1 space from Row 1, work 2 double crochets.
- Chain 1, then in the next chain-1 space, work (2 dc, chain 1, 2 dc).
- Chain 1, then work 1 double crochet in the 3rd chain of the turning chain from Row 1.
- Turn your work.
Step 4: Repeat Row 2
Continue to repeat Row 2, increasing by 4 double crochets in each row. This means that you will add 2 double crochets in each chain-1 space and 1 double crochet in the turning chain of the previous row. Keep repeating until your shawl reaches the desired size.
Step 5: Create the Ribbed Edge
- Once you have reached your desired size, attach your yarn to one corner of the shawl.
- Work in front post double crochet (fpdc) around the edge for the first row.
- For the next row, work in back post double crochet (bpdc) around the edge.
- Continue alternating between fpdc and bpdc for a total of 5 rows.
Step 6: Finishing Touches
Once you have completed the ribbed edge, fasten off your yarn. Be sure to weave in any loose ends using a yarn needle to give your shawl a clean finish.
